9260 USB无线网卡驱动移植
2016-05-20 19:27
337 查看
USB无线网卡型号:VT6656 TL-TW321G+等
1、驱动Makefile文件修改
一般只需在$(MAKE) 添加 -C /嵌入式内核目录
例如:
modules:
$(MAKE) -C /home/work/linux-2.6.20 M=$(TOP_DIR) LDDINC=$(TOP_DIR) modules
make -C /home/work/linux-2.6.20 SUBDIRS=$(shell pwd) modules
执行make后生成驱动,2.4内核文件名为 *.o , 2.6内核文件名为*.ko
复制生成的驱动文件到nfs文件系统。
2、下载wireless_tools.29.tar.gz,解压,修改 Makefile文件
修改安装目录为nfs文件系统的位置,
PREFIX =/home/share/root91/usr/local
修改编译器
CC=arm-linux-gcc
AR=arm-linux-ar
make
make install
3、配置USB网卡
将USB网卡插到板子上,安装驱动程序
insmod rt73.ko
iwconfig 查看无线网卡的设备名,可能为rausb0 ,wlan0 等
ifconfig wlan0 IP_ADDR
iwconfig wlan0 key s:12345
iwconfig wlan0 essid huiweit
配置完毕,ping测试一下网络通不通。
1、驱动Makefile文件修改
一般只需在$(MAKE) 添加 -C /嵌入式内核目录
例如:
modules:
$(MAKE) -C /home/work/linux-2.6.20 M=$(TOP_DIR) LDDINC=$(TOP_DIR) modules
make -C /home/work/linux-2.6.20 SUBDIRS=$(shell pwd) modules
执行make后生成驱动,2.4内核文件名为 *.o , 2.6内核文件名为*.ko
复制生成的驱动文件到nfs文件系统。
2、下载wireless_tools.29.tar.gz,解压,修改 Makefile文件
修改安装目录为nfs文件系统的位置,
PREFIX =/home/share/root91/usr/local
修改编译器
CC=arm-linux-gcc
AR=arm-linux-ar
make
make install
3、配置USB网卡
将USB网卡插到板子上,安装驱动程序
insmod rt73.ko
iwconfig 查看无线网卡的设备名,可能为rausb0 ,wlan0 等
ifconfig wlan0 IP_ADDR
iwconfig wlan0 key s:12345
iwconfig wlan0 essid huiweit
配置完毕,ping测试一下网络通不通。
相关文章推荐
- Linux下MTK 3G网卡驱动移植
- Linux 下蓝牙驱动移植
- 在mini210 上面实现rt3070ap功能的移植内核版本 是linux3.0.8
- 在移植rt3070驱动的时候编译遇到的问题
- zedboard--ubuntu12.04(基于pc机)编译globalmem驱动
- tiny6410(mini6410)移植RT5370方案USBWIFI网卡
- S5PC100芯片的linux-lcd驱动移植(基于2.6.35.13内核)
- S5pc100 的linux 触摸屏驱动移植(linux 2.6.35.13内核)
- AT91SAM9260手册关于Power Management Controller章节翻译
- SAM-BA 2.14 reconfiguration----DIY你的sam-ba
- Atmel ARM9启动流程与Bootstrap的大小内幕
- JZ2440学习笔记,第二部分,移植uboot2015支持JZ2440的nor flash
- ARM-Linux驱动--DM9000网卡驱动分析(二)
- 在tiny6410 上使用USB无线网卡 --W311M
- Tiny6410 移植RT5370 USB无线网卡的方法
- 网卡移植
- Debian桌面编译安装Tenda U1 USB无线网卡驱动
- 用USB无线网卡在新平台全新移植并构建Linux无线网络
- 基于Dragonboard 410c 的Grove - Digital Light Sensor驱动移植
- Android底层驱动移植--gslx680电容触摸屏驱动